Career path

Career Role (Environmental Public Relations & EIA) Description
Environmental Consultant (EIA Specialist) Conducting Environmental Impact Assessments, advising clients on environmental regulations, and preparing reports. High demand for EIA expertise.
Public Relations Officer (Environmental Focus) Managing communication strategies, engaging stakeholders, and building public trust for environmental projects. Strong communication and stakeholder management skills are essential.
Sustainability Manager (Environmental PR) Developing and implementing sustainability initiatives, managing environmental reporting, and communicating sustainability performance. Requires a blend of environmental and business acumen.
Environmental Communications Specialist Creating compelling content (reports, presentations, social media) to communicate complex environmental issues to various audiences. Excellent writing and presentation skills are vital.
Environmental Policy Analyst (EIA & PR) Analyzing environmental policies, assessing their impacts, and communicating policy implications to stakeholders. Strong analytical and policy understanding is needed.
